Liberian Disabled People’s “Work Issues” Rekindled on Swedish-Italian Partnership

MONROVIA – The work-related lamentations from members of Liberia’s disability community have been amplified, again, to attract attention of Liberian Government, the private employment sector, and entire Global Community. This has been going on over decades, especially in post-civil war period that is characterized with intensification of discrimination against persons living with disabilities in every public work place unlike prejudicial treatment against jobseekers/employees with no form of deformity.   ....
